  • For a truly succulent and juicy chicken, look no further than this best easy chicken marinade. With just a handful of ingredients, you can elevate your ordinary chicken into a flavour-packed delight. Start with a base of natural yoghurt or buttermilk, which not only tenderises the meat but also imparts a lovely creaminess. To this, add a splash of olive oil, a drizzle of honey for a hint of sweetness, and a generous sprinkle of salt and cracked black pepper. For an aromatic kick, include minced garlic, fresh herbs like thyme or rosemary, and a squeeze of fresh lemon juice to brighten the flavours. Allow the chicken to marinate for at least an hour—or better yet, overnight—before grilling or baking. The result? Juicy, tender chicken that is bursting with flavour, sure to impress at any meal.

  • The best sausage stuffing recipe is a true delight for the senses, transforming a humble dish into a festive centerpiece. Begin by selecting high-quality sausages; a blend of pork and herb-infused varieties adds depth and flavour. In a large mixing bowl, combine the crumbled sausage meat with freshly diced onions, celery, and aromatic garlic—sauté these ingredients until they’re tender and fragrant.

    Next, fold in generous amounts of day-old bread, preferably a rustic white or brioche for a touch of sweetness. To elevate the stuffing, add a medley of herbs: thyme, sage, and parsley work wonders. A splash of chicken stock and a whisked egg help bind the mixture, ensuring each morsel is moist and flavourful.

    Once combined, transfer the stuffing into a buttered baking dish and bake until golden and crisp on top. The result is a heavenly concoction that marries the heartiness of sausage with the comforting elements of bread and herbs, making it the perfect accompaniment to your festive roast. Serve it piping hot, and watch it disappear from the serving platter as everyone clamours for a second helping.

  • Indulge in the delightful flavours of autumn with the best cranberry apple crisp recipe ever! This delectable dessert combines the tartness of fresh cranberries with the sweetness of ripe apples, creating a perfect harmony of flavours that is simply irresistible.

    To start, you'll need a mix of crisp, tart apples—like Bramleys or Coxes—peeled and sliced, and a generous handful of fresh cranberries. Combine them in a bowl with a sprinkle of sugar and a hint of cinnamon, allowing the fruits to meld together beautifully.

    The true magic lies in the crisp topping. A blend of rolled oats, flour, brown sugar, and cold butter, combined to achieve a crumbly texture, enhances this scrumptious dish. For that extra touch, add a handful of chopped walnuts or almonds for a delightful crunch.

    Bake it until golden brown, and as it fills your kitchen with the warm, inviting aroma of spiced fruit, you'll know you've created something special. Serve warm with a dollop of clotted cream or a scoop of creamy vanilla ice cream, and you'll understand why this cranberry apple crisp is regarded as the ultimate autumnal treat. Enjoy every mouthful!

  • Indulging in chocolate-covered strawberries is a delightful experience, combining the sweetness of ripe strawberries with the rich, decadent allure of chocolate. For the best chocolate-covered strawberries, it’s essential to use high-quality ingredients. Start with fresh, plump strawberries – preferably organic – as they provide a burst of juicy flavour.

    Melt 200g of good-quality dark chocolate (around 70% cocoa) in a heatproof bowl set over a pan of simmering water, ensuring the bowl doesn’t touch the water. Stir gently until smooth, then remove from heat and allow to cool slightly.

    While the chocolate is cooling, rinse the strawberries under cool water, then dry them thoroughly with a clean tea towel – any moisture will hinder the chocolate from adhering properly.

    Dip each strawberry into the melted chocolate, allowing any excess to drip off before placing them onto a tray lined with baking parchment. For an extra touch, consider sprinkling a bit of sea salt or chopped nuts over the chocolate before it sets.

    Refrigerate the strawberries for about 30 minutes to allow the chocolate to firm up. Serve chilled for a refreshing treat that’s perfect for any occasion – or simply as a luscious indulgence for yourself! Enjoy the perfect marriage of flavours with each delightful bite.

  • Caesar dressing is a classic staple that elevates a simple salad to new heights with its rich, creamy texture and bold, savoury flavours. The best homemade Caesar dressing combines key ingredients to create that irresistible taste we've all come to love. Start with a base of fresh garlic and anchovy fillets, which bring depth and umami to the mixture. Whisk in egg yolks, Dijon mustard, and a splash of Worcestershire sauce for added complexity. As you drizzle in high-quality olive oil, the dressing transforms into a luscious emulsion, while freshly grated Parmesan cheese adds a touch of nuttiness.

    For an extra zing, a squeeze of lemon juice brightens the flavours beautifully, creating a well-rounded dressing that’s both delightful and satisfying. This homemade Caesar dressing not only enhances crunchy romaine lettuce but also pairs wonderfully with grilled chicken, crusty bread, or even as a dipping sauce for fresh vegetables. Quick to make and bursting with flavour, it’s the perfect addition to any meal. Once you've tried this simple recipe, you’ll never want to reach for a store-bought alternative again!
